Brinn Trousdale

Client Service Manager

Brinn Trousdale is a financial professional at Moneta, holding a cum laude degree in Business Administration from Mizzou with an emphasis in Finance and a minor in Economics and certificates in Personal Financial Planning and Investments. Her involvement in Delta Sigma Pi, Phi Mu, the Mizzou Panhellenic Council, highlights her commitment to community service and leadership.

Brinn began her career at Charles Schwab as a client service and support intern, where she passed the SIE exam. She was attracted to Moneta for its collaborative nature and high standards and aims to pursue the C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 designation to better serve her clients.

Living in Ballwin, MO, Brinn enjoys hiking, running, reading, and playing pickleball. She loves spending time in Forest Park, attending shows at The Muny, and cheering for the Cardinals and the Blues.
